开通会员
  • 尊享所有功能
  • 文件大小最高200M
  • 文件无水印
  • 尊贵VIP身份
  • VIP专属服务
  • 历史记录保存30天云存储
开通会员
您的位置:首页 > 帮助中心 > java 读取pdf文件内容_Java读取PDF文件内容全解析
默认会员免费送
帮助中心 >

java 读取pdf文件内容_Java读取PDF文件内容全解析

2025-01-21 19:47:47
java 读取pdf文件内容_java读取pdf文件内容全解析
## java读取pdf文件内容

在java中,我们可以使用第三方库来读取pdf文件内容。其中,apache pdfbox是一个流行的选择。

首先,需要将pdfbox库添加到项目依赖中。然后,通过以下基本步骤读取pdf内容:

1. 加载pdf文档。使用`pddocument.load()`方法,传入pdf文件的路径或输入流。
2. 获取文档中的页面。通过`pddocument.getnumberofpages()`确定页面数量,再循环获取每个页面。
3. 从页面中提取文本。使用`pdftextstripper`类,将页面内容转换为文本。

示例代码如下:

```java
import org.apache.pdfbox.pdmodel.pddocument;
import org.apache.pdfbox.text.pdftextstripper;

public class readpdf {
public static void main(string[] args) throws exception {
pddocument document = pddocument.load(new file("example.pdf"));
pdftextstripper stripper = new pdftextstripper();
string text = stripper.gettext(document);
system.out.println(text);
document.close();
}
}
```

通过这些步骤,就可以在java中读取pdf文件的内容了。

java如何读取pdf文件

java如何读取pdf文件
《java读取pdf文件》

在java中读取pdf文件可以借助外部库。例如,apache pdfbox是一个常用的选择。

首先,需要在项目中导入pdfbox相关的依赖。然后,通过如下步骤读取pdf。创建pddocument对象,使用`pddocument.load(new file("yourpdf.pdf"))`加载pdf文件。获取文档中的页面,通过`pddocument.getnumberofpages()`获取总页数,再循环遍历各页面。对于每一页,可以提取文本内容等操作。例如,利用`pdftextstripper`类来提取文本,创建`pdftextstripper`对象并调用`gettext`方法传入`pddocument`对象来得到文本内容。最后,操作完成后要使用`pddocument.close()`关闭文档,以释放资源。这样就能在java中有效地读取pdf文件内容了。

java获取pdf内容

java获取pdf内容
java获取pdf内容

在java中,我们可以利用一些库来获取pdf内容。其中,apache pdfbox是常用的选择。

首先,需要在项目中引入pdfbox相关的依赖。然后,通过加载pdf文件创建pddocument对象。利用pdftextstripper类,能够将pdf中的文本提取出来。例如:

```java
import org.apache.pdfbox.pdmodel.pddocument;
import org.apache.pdfbox.text.pdftextstripper;

public class pdfreader {
public static void main(string[] args) throws exception {
pddocument document = pddocument.load(new file("example.pdf"));
pdftextstripper stripper = new pdftextstripper();
string text = stripper.gettext(document);
system.out.println(text);
document.close();
}
}
```

这样就可以简单有效地获取pdf中的文字内容,从而进行进一步的处理,如内容分析、信息检索等。

java解析pdf文件

java解析pdf文件
# java解析pdf文件

在java中,解析pdf文件可以借助一些强大的库。例如,apache pdfbox就是常用的选择。

使用pdfbox时,首先要将其相关的依赖添加到项目中。然后,通过简单的代码就可以读取pdf内容。例如,加载pdf文件并提取文本。它可以逐页处理pdf,获取文本内容、字体信息等。对于需要从pdf中提取数据用于进一步分析或处理的应用场景非常有用。

另外,itext也能用于pdf解析。它不仅可以解析,还能创建和操作pdf文件。java开发人员利用这些库,可以方便地处理pdf相关的任务,如文档内容提取、数据挖掘等,满足多种业务需求。
您已连续签到 0 天,当前积分:0
  • 第1天
    积分+10
  • 第2天
    积分+10
  • 第3天
    积分+10
  • 第4天
    积分+10
  • 第5天
    积分+10
  • 第6天
    积分+10
  • 第7天

    连续签到7天

    获得积分+10

获得10积分

明天签到可得10积分

咨询客服

扫描二维码,添加客服微信